- ** DISPUTED ** A Buffer Overflow vulnerability exists in NumPy 1.9.x in the PyArray_NewFromDescr_int
function of ctors.c when specifying arrays of large dimensions (over 32) from Python code, which could let
a malicious user cause a Denial of Service. NOTE: The vendor does not agree this is a vulneraility; In
(very limited) circumstances a user may be able provoke the buffer overflow, the user is most likely
already privileged to at least provoke denial of service by exhausting memory. Triggering this further
requires the use of uncommon API (complicated structured dtypes), which is very unlikely to be available
to an unprivileged user. (CVE-2021-33430)
- ** DISPUTED ** Buffer overflow in the array_from_pyobj function of fortranobject.c in NumPy < 1.19, which
allows attackers to conduct a Denial of Service attacks by carefully constructing an array with negative
values. NOTE: The vendor does not agree this is a vulnerability; the negative dimensions can only be
created by an already privileged user (or internally). (CVE-2021-41496)
